Market Overview
Nature Identical Flavorings are synthetic substances that are chemically identical to natural flavor compounds found in various fruits, vegetables, and other natural sources. These flavorings are widely used in the food and beverage industry to enhance the taste and aroma of products. Nature identical flavorings offer several advantages over natural flavors, including consistency, cost-effectiveness, and availability throughout the year.

Category-wise Insights
- Fruits: Nature identical flavorings derived from fruits, such as strawberry, orange, and apple, are widely used in beverages, confectionery, and dairy products. These flavors provide a refreshing and authentic taste experience.
- Vegetables: Vegetable-based nature identical flavorings, including tomato, carrot, and garlic, are commonly used in savory products, sauces, and snacks. These flavors enhance the natural taste of the ingredients.
- Spices: Nature identical flavorings derived from spices, such as cinnamon, ginger, and vanilla, are popular in bakery products, desserts, and beverages. These flavors add warmth and depth to the final products.
- Dairy: Dairy-based nature identical flavorings, such as chocolate, vanilla, and strawberry, are extensively used in ice creams, yogurts, and milkshakes. These flavors provide a rich and creamy taste.
